Output 7045e61241caf630df5a974f9ac7b495c8a96dbe3de40ee2d177197737651c17:0

value
325259
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b1bf8933fd76bf46467a88a66b0a5de44c369bf5 OP_EQUAL
address
3HtryeatNwDYvmKquKDgN4BB1tWmcqR4ja
transaction
7045e61241caf630df5a974f9ac7b495c8a96dbe3de40ee2d177197737651c17
spent
true